wowfudge · 22/03/2015 11:15

Is there underfloor heating? I really think without that tiled floors in your living room could be a huge mistake. Do please bear in mind that anything you drop is likely to smash and should anything heavy get dropped it could also damage the tiles.

If you have dogs it will be a total pain in the ass to keep the tiles clean and shiny, especially if you are going for a high gloss finish. It will also be noisy (we've had dogs so the noise on tiles and on laminate can be bad). Can your dog even cope with walking on those tiled floors in your pics?

If I were you I would seriously consider putting Karndean or Amtico down instead. Warm underfoot, good sound damping, easy to clean and non slip.

All those pale, shiny finishes reflect light and make a show home look big and luxurious. The reality in a real life home can be somewhat different.
